Swetha 5-10 Wellington Road is one of those films that creeps up on you. It’s a tightly woven thriller centered around a young woman who stumbles into a house where tension hangs in the air. The atmosphere is thick with suspense, and you can feel the weight of her predicament. The pacing has a nice rhythm, drawing you in as she navigates through the three characters that shape her experience—each with their own quirks and motives. What I find distinctive here are the practical effects, which add a tangible layer to the unsettling moments. Performances are decent; there's an intensity that comes through, making you question what’s real and what’s not. It’s this blend of psychological tension and character exploration that keeps you engaged.
